<p>PURPOSE:To improve the signal to clutter ratio to a specific target body; by varying the frequency of a sent pulse train at intervals of (n) pulses and varying the radiation condition of a main beam with time corresponding to an integration time. CONSTITUTION:A sent pulse signal with a pulse repetition period is outputted from a transmission part 5 with a specific timing signal sent from a time control part 7, and outputted to a specific investigation space with main beams from a transmission/reception switch part 4 and an antenna 1. Further, a main beam control part 2 controls radiation characteristics of a main beam radiated from an antenna part 1 with time with a specific timing signal sent from the control part 7. Then, a reflected signal from a specific target body such as a peripheral fixed reflector is inputted to a reception part 6 through the antenna part 1 and switch part 4, and demodulated by the reception part 6 and inputted to a signal processing part 8, which performs non-coherent integral processing for the received signal which are inputted at an integration time and detected with the specific timing signal inputted from the control part 7, so that the received signal is outputted after the non-coherent integration processing.</p> |
